Road drain installation requires a variety of tools and materials to ensure proper functionality and durability. Trench shovels are essential for digging trenches to accommodate the drain pipes. Measuring tapes and marking chalk help accurately determine the placement and alignment of the drains. Levels and screed boards are necessary for ensuring the proper slope and grade of the trench. PVC drain pipes are commonly used for road drain installations due to their durability and resistance to corrosion. Pipe connectors and elbows facilitate the connection of the drain pipes, while pipe cutters and glue ensure secure and leak-free joints. Catch basins and grates are crucial components that collect and filter debris from the water flow. Geotextile fabric is often used as a filter material to prevent soil particles from entering the drain system. Backfill materials such as gravel or crushed stone are used to fill the trench and provide stability to the drain pipes. Compactors are utilized to compact the backfill material, ensuring a solid foundation for the road drain. Concrete is commonly used to create a sturdy base for the catch basins and grates. Safety equipment such as hard hats, gloves, safety glasses, and high-visibility vests are essential to protect workers during the installation process. These tools and materials are crucial for a successful road drain installation, ensuring effective water drainage and preventing potential road damage.

Catch basins are an essential component of road drain installation, designed to effectively manage stormwater runoff and prevent flooding on roads and highways. These basins, typically made of concrete or precast materials, are strategically placed along the road to collect and redirect excess water during heavy rain or snowmelt. They feature a grated inlet that allows water to flow into an underground chamber, where sediment and debris settle, while the clean water is discharged through an outlet pipe into a nearby drainage system or natural watercourse. Catch basins not only help prevent road damage and erosion but also contribute to the overall safety and functionality of road networks by minimizing the risk of hydroplaning and maintaining proper drainage.

Geotextile fabric is a versatile material that can be effectively used for road drain installation. This specialized fabric is designed to enhance the performance and longevity of road drainage systems. By acting as a filter, geotextile fabric prevents fine soil particles from clogging the drainage system while allowing water to pass through freely. During road drain installation, geotextile fabric is typically placed around the drain pipe to create a protective barrier. It helps to prevent soil intrusion and the accumulation of debris, ensuring the proper functioning of the drainage system. Additionally, the fabric helps to distribute the load evenly, minimizing the risk of pipe damage caused by external pressure. Geotextile fabric also plays a crucial role in soil stabilization. It helps to prevent the migration of soil particles, reducing the potential for erosion and maintaining the integrity of the road structure. By reinforcing the soil, geotextile fabric enhances the overall stability and performance of the road,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high water table. In summary, geotextile fabric is an essential component in road drain installation. It improves the efficiency of drainage systems, protects pipes from clogging, and enhances soil stabilization. Its use ensures the longevity and functionality of road infrastructure, promoting safer and more sustainable transportation networks.

Compactors play a crucial role in road drain installation by ensuring proper compaction of the surrounding soil and the roadbed. These heavy-duty machines are designed to compact and compress loose soil, gravel, or asphalt, creating a stable and durable foundation for road drains. During road drain installation, compactors are used to compact the soil around the drain pipes, ensuring that there are no voids or gaps that could lead to future settlement or damage. By applying pressure and vibrations, compactors increase the density and stability of the soil, preventing potential issues such as sinkholes or uneven settling. Compact and maneuverable, these machines can easily navigate tight spaces and reach areas where larger construction equipment may have limited access. They come in various sizes and types, including plate compactors, trench compactors, and vibratory rollers, each suitable for different types of road drain installation projects. Overall, compactors are essential tools for road drain installation, as they ensure proper compaction, improve drainage efficiency, and contribute to the longevity and durability of road infrastructure.
